    Damages

    A truck accident involving commercial vehicles could result in serious injuries, which can lead to permanent disfigurement and permanent disability. The damage can be difficult to calculate in terms of financial compensation, therefore it's crucial to speak to an attorney before making any legal move.

    Economic damage: This includes medical bills, prescription medication costs, rehabilitation and therapy fees loss of wages, damaged property. Your lawyer will collect and organize these data to help you prove your claim.

    Non-economic damages: These include pain and suffering emotional stress, loss of normal living. These kinds of damages are usually given to victims who have been severely injured or died.

    Punitive damages are offered in a limited number of cases. However they can be useful in cases where the defendant's actions were extremely negligent or unjustifiable. These damages are meant to punish the trucker, employer or maintenance company and ensure that they will be held liable for future harm.

    Time Limits

    The time it takes to bring a personal or wrongful-death suit differs from one state to another, most states require that you file your claim within a specific time. This is called a statute-of-limits and, if you do not submit your claim within this time frame, your case will likely be dismissed.

    The statute of limitations in New York for a personal injury and wrongful death lawsuit is three years from the date of the accident. This time limit may be reduced or extended depending on the circumstances of your case.

    Expert Witnesses

    A commercial truck accident lawyer will require evidence and expert witnesses to prove negligence. This could mean sifting through logbooks for the driver looking over the technical information from the truck accident lawyer columbia sc, and using expert witnesses to form their opinions.

    A jury could take a long time to decide who's at fault when the case goes to court. It is crucial to act swiftly following an accident. The faster you notify us the sooner we'll be able to begin collecting evidence and building your case.

    Our Seattle truck accident lawyers are well-versed in the law and can make use of expert witnesses when needed. We also know what kinds of experts will most likely to aid your case.

    A medical professional is the first expert we call. They'll testify on the seriousness of your injuries as well as how they affected your life. They could be a physician or emergency medicine specialist or someone who saw you prior to the accident and is familiar with your current health. They'll also be able to explain the long-term effects of your injuries to the jury.

    It is also possible to call a vocational expert who will review your work experience, education and physical condition prior to the accident. This will assist the jury discern how your impairment in the workplace has affected your job prospects.

    Another expert that we often bring in is an economist. An economist can give you financial figures to demonstrate how your impairment has affected your earning potential. If your injury causes you to be incapable of performing 20% of the jobs you were qualified for before the accident, this will result in a specific amount of money you will lose each year.

    Last but not least, we could have an engineer recreate the crash to provide a more accurate account of what happened. This will allow the jury to clearly understand what caused your accident and how they could have avoided it.
